Output 27edb006e52c1c08eb7299ef3232ec2b6f83ea030a211f5b1adc7fae121b5430:3

value
89524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f52e2df22aaef1b1e31f4fe2761e88432ee2070b OP_EQUAL
address
3Q3Qo9Zjh99hBAQFyADNd3yMK8HuRV1aQa
transaction
27edb006e52c1c08eb7299ef3232ec2b6f83ea030a211f5b1adc7fae121b5430
spent
true